Jason Schroeder shares the one practice that transformed his job sites more than any other: daily worker huddles.
Drawing from years of hard-earned field experience (and some brutal early-morning chaos as a young finisher), Jason walks you through how consistent, intentional worker huddles:
Build culture and belonging on site.
Radically improve communication, safety, and productivity.
Eliminate firefighting, confusion, and drama.
Create a stable, boring (in the best way) project environment.
Give real respect to the workers who actually build the project.
